Abstract

The invention relates to the technical field of laser welding equipment, in particular to a laser welding protection device. The laser welding protection device comprises a welding pedestal, wherein amiddle baffle plate and an upper baffle plate are fixedly connected on the welding pedestal in sequence from bottom to top; a welding hole, a middle welding hole and an upper welding hole capable ofallowing laser to pass through are separately formed in the welding pedestal, the middle baffle plate and the upper baffle plate; protection devices are separately arranged in the middle welding holeand the upper welding hole; the protection devices are connected to a waste slag recycling device arranged inside the pedestal through pipelines; and fans are arranged on the pipelines. The laser welding protection device can effectively protect a laser lens, and also can reduce pollution on a surrounding environment.

technical field [0001] The invention relates to the technical field of laser welding equipment, in particular to a laser welding protection device. Background technique [0002] Laser welding is a process in which high-power focused laser beams are used as heat sources, and the laser beams are directly irradiated on the surface of the material to make the surface of the material heat and transmit it to the inside of the material, so that the materials are melted and connected to form an excellent welded joint. Laser welding can be divided into pulse laser welding and continuous laser welding. According to its thermodynamic mechanism, it can be divided into laser heat conduction welding and laser deep penetration welding, or laser deep penetration welding. The application of laser welding began in 1964, but in the early days it was limited to the welding of thin and small parts with low-power pulsed solid-state lasers.
